JL has coordinates J(-6, 1) and L(-4,3).
Find the coordinates of the midpoint.

Answer:

The coordinates of the mid-point of JL are (-5 , 2)

Explanation:

If point (x , y) is the mid-point of a segment whose end-points are
(x_(1),y_(1)) and
(x_(2),y_(2)), then
x=(x_(1)+x_(2))/(2) and
y=(y_(1)+y_(2))/(2)

∵ JL is a segment

∵ The coordinates of J are (-6 , 1)


x_(1) = -6 and
y_(1) = 1

∵ The coordinates of L are (-4 , 3)


x_(2) = -4 and
y_(2) = 3

Lets use the rule above to find the mid-point of JL


x=(-6+-4)/(2)=(-10)/(2)

x = -5

∴ The x-coordinate of the mid-point is -5


y=(1+3)/(2)=(4)/(2)

y = 2

∴ The y-coordinate of the mid-point is 2

The coordinates of the mid-point of JL are (-5 , 2)
